What busses are most fuel efficient?

Fuel efficiency Fuel efficiencies used in this analysis were as follows: diesel bus: 4.82 miles per diesel gallon; diesel-hybrid bus: 5.84 miles per diesel gallon; natural gas bus: 4.47 miles per diesel gallon equivalent; and battery electric bus: 2.02 kWh per mile, which accounts for a 90 percent charging efficiency.

Transit buses are a LITTLE more fuel-efficient, but not as much as many people might think. A car (24.2 MPG) with the national-average of 1.5 passengers gets 36.3 PPMG (Passenger Miles per Gallon). A transit bus (3.3 MPG) with a national average load (9.1 passengers) gets 30 PPMG.

A diesel engine requires less fuel to produce the same output as a gas engine. A conventional gas engine operates via a spark ignition system, which burns more fuel than a diesel engine's combustion system. As a result, diesel buses are more fuel-efficient per gallon and burn less fuel while idling.

Diesel school buses are already the most fuel-efficient in the industry, due to a higher BTU count compared to other fuels, providing better fuel economy and a longer operating range compared to similar-sized gasoline, propane or compressed natural gas (CNG) engines.

A typical school bus burns approximately one-half gallon of diesel fuel for each hour it idles. Thus, if a company operates 50 buses and each bus reduces its idling time by 30 minutes per day, at $1per gallon of diesel fuel, the company would save $2,250 per school year in fuel costs.

Executive buses average 6 miles per gallon, especially when it comes to larger models that carry 45 to 51 passengers. Newer, high-tech models may get up to 10 to 12 miles per gallon. The larger the bus, the lower the average mileage.

According to the U.S. Department of Energy, the average school bus travels 12,000 miles per year 4. At the average school bus mpg, that means a single school bus would use about 1,993 gallons of fuel annually.
